My 10 year old informed me they received a spam call today... by Shankles_Mcnasty in GoogleFi

[–]cmdrchkn 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I have that setting enabled for my line to block spam texts, but I've noticed that some actual business numbers can still get through even if I don't have them saved.

So far it's been legitimate stuff like a login code from my bank or grubhub using a new short number, but it clearly doesn't actually block "anything not in your contacts" like the setting claims. There is a listed exception for numbers you've recently called, but at least for me the new numbers were not ones I'd ever contacted

LED Light Not Working - Board Issue? by [deleted] in originalxbox

[–]cmdrchkn 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I have 2 1.0 boxes that had trace rot due to the clock cap that caused issues with the buttons, but the led signals are right next to the button traces along the underside of the board. This forum post has some pictures of what the damage might look like, but basically you'll need to repair or bypass the traces

Worst customer service by luoxiongtian in GoogleFi

[–]cmdrchkn 5 points6 points  (0 children)

Afaik that's how the plan works. Up to 22GB unthrottled, then throttled or $10/gig. I've also never heard of them doing business lines

https://fi.google.com/about/plans/

Anyone who uses more than 15 GB on Flexible or 22 GB on the unlimited plans in a single cycle will experience slower data until the next cycle (only 1% of people who use Fi ever hit 22 GB). If you want to return to faster data before the cycle's end, you can do so at a rate of $10/GB.
